Alabama finished the regular season 12-0. The consensus No. 1, some in the media, including SDS columnist Connor O’Gara, believe the Crimson Tide are in the College Football Playoff’s final four win or lose against Georgia Saturday in the SEC Championship Game.

ESPN’s CFP expert Heather Dinich weighed in on that storyline during a Tuesday appearance on “The Paul Finebaum Show.” Dinich tells Finebaum it would have to be a “close loss” for Alabama to remain in the top four.
